Overview of the First Alert SC9120B
The First Alert SC9120B is a combination smoke and carbon monoxide detector designed to provide protection against fires and harmful gas leaks. This device is part of a series of smoke and carbon monoxide alarms offered by First Alert, a well-known brand in the safety equipment industry. The SC9120B model is a hardwired combination alarm that includes a battery backup, ensuring continued function during power outages. It features a test/silence button and uses electrochemical CO sensing technology and an ionization sensor for smoke detection. The device is intended for residential use and is compatible with most home electrical systems. Electrochemical CO Sensing Technology and Ionization Sensor
The First Alert SC9120B utilizes electrochemical CO sensing technology to detect carbon monoxide levels in the air, providing accurate and reliable readings. This technology is combined with an ionization sensor to detect smoke particles, allowing for comprehensive detection of potential hazards. The ionization sensor is highly sensitive to small particles, making it ideal for detecting fast-flaming fires. The combination of these two technologies provides a high level of protection against both carbon monoxide poisoning and fires. The electrochemical CO sensing technology is also highly resistant to false alarms, reducing the likelihood of unnecessary evacuations. NFPA Recommendations for Smoke Alarm Replacement
The National Fire Protection Association (NFPA) recommends replacing smoke alarms every 10 years to ensure they remain effective in detecting fires and alerting occupants. This recommendation is based on research and testing that shows smoke alarms can lose sensitivity over time, reducing their ability to detect smoke and warn people of potential fires. The NFPA also suggests that smoke alarms be tested monthly and cleaned regularly to ensure they are working properly. Procedure for Obtaining a Hard Copy of the First Alert Manual
To obtain a hard copy of the First Alert manual, users can contact the Support team at 1-800-323-9005 and request a replacement manual. The team will guide users through the process and provide information on the required fee.
